Description
A circular-top conical shaped bundle with bi-coloured geometric design covering the entire bundle.
Radiographs and CT show evidence of reeds laid longitudinally with a radiodense anomaly at the proximal end of the bundle. The radiodensity of the outer layers of linen wrappings are obvious in CT images. Radiodense patches of resinous substances that have dried upon application and have fractured over time are obvious in the mid-layers.
Museum Acquisition Number: 11296
